Product: dimethyladenosine transferase
Products: NA
Alternate protein names: 16S rRNA (adenine(1518)-N(6)/adenine(1519)-N(6))-dimethyltransferase; 16S rRNA dimethyladenosine transferase; 16S rRNA dimethylase; S-adenosylmethionine-6-N', N'-adenosyl(rRNA) dimethyltransferase [H]

Specific function: Specifically dimethylates two adjacent adenosines (A1518 and A1519) in the loop of a conserved hairpin near the 3'-end of 16S rRNA in the 30S particle. May play a critical role in biogenesis of 30S subunits [H]
COG id: COG0030
COG function: function code J; Dimethyladenosine transferase (rRNA methylation)
